Synopsis

Books of the Marvels of the World or Description of the World (Divisament dou monde), also nicknamed Il Milione ("The Million") or Oriente Poliano and commonly called The Travels of Marco Polo, is a 13th-century travelogue by Rustichello da Pisa and Marco Polo, describing the supposed travels of the latter through Asia, Persia, China, and Indonesia between 1271 and 1298. It was a very famous and popular book in the 13th century.
